TRAINER (EDUCATION), BASHIQA-NINEWA

Job Overview

The Trainer (Education) will be responsible for the following duties and responsibilities:

The Trainer is assigned with the responsibility to guarantee the effective implementation of the project activities.

Under direct supervision of Filed coordinator and PM, the tutor of teachers will be responsible for coordination of the activities in his/her area of responsibility, including coordination with DoE, partner NGO in this project and other stakeholders. S/he will ensure internal and external reporting in compliance with FOCSIV and the donor’s procedures and that expected results attainment in budget management. S/He ensures the delivery of the activities on time, on-quality, on-budget.

Main Duties & Responsibilities:

  • In coordination with Education Officer and Head of Programs set-up work plan for activities in compliance with projects results and donor requirements.
  • Liaise with DoE staff, school staff, educators, and Local Partner to identify needed capacity building training.
  • Responsible for planning and implementation of capacity building training.
  • Assess the needs for goods/services to support activities and report them to the Education Officer, ensuring follow-up of procurements with Logistic department.
  • In coordination with local partners, support training needs assessments to identify outcomes of trainings and prepare reports to feed into relevant project reports.
  • Participate in formal and non-formal education activities.
  • Support the creation of community events to promote the education and social inclusion of children with disabilities.
  • In partnership with local stakeholders (NGOs, National Society, DoE), ensure proper follow-up of the educational activities and specific community events for the benefit of the children, their families, and the community in order to promote social cohesion and the correct school management and educational planning.
  • Responsible for regular reports such as daily, weekly, monthly…etc.
  • Ensure that data are collected, archived, processed, analyzed and disseminated in ethical modalities, in line with internal data protection protocols.
  • Undertake regular field monitoring visits to assess ongoing activities and prepare reports to monitor quality of program implementation.
  • Ensure a positive work environment, showing sensitivity and understanding in resolving conflicts and facilitating productive discussions with staff and stakeholders.
  • Ensure activities are implemented in line with FOCSIV Code of Conduct, Standard Operational Procedures (SOPs), policies and guidelines.
  • Perform any other task assigned by the line manager.

 

Skills and Qualifications REQUIRED

  • Bachelor’s degree in social sciences, Economic, Social work or other field related to social development and humanitarian work.
  • Minimum of 3 years of relevant experience
  • Expertise in facilitating and convey in simple manner education topics (INEE, Positive Parenting, Social Cohesion) to headmasters, teachers and parents.
  • Ability to plan trainings activities to reach target results and objectives, including delivery of pre- and post-tests.
  • Experienced in preparing training reports and follow-up on excel sheets.
  • Ability to plan and organize work under pressure and in a rapidly changing environment.
  • Solid team working and management skills in multicultural environment.
  • Positive, problem solver and dynamic with ability to motivate and guide staff.
  • Good level of English (written and oral).

Fluent in Arabic and Kurdish
